Water Pump Surge

We just spent five nights in a partial hook-up park. We used our own shower a few times instead of the public showers. Everything worked fine till the last night. When the shower was running the water pump sounded as though it was surging. I thought perhaps the tank was getting low, so I filled the tank but the problem persisted. Now, the bathroom sink faucet runs just fine as does the kitchen sick faucet. Normally, when using the pump there is just a steady purr. With the shower it goes louder, then softer. Water pressure seems to stay the same. Trailer is a Starwood 5th wheel, by McKenzie. Where should I start looking for the problem? Thanks.

  • Mr. Wizard: I removed the OEM (2005) shower nozzle and low and behold it purred like a new born kitten. Put the nozzle back on and the surging sound started up again. I've been putting off ordering a new Oxygenics shower head but I guess it's finally time.:) Thanks for your help.
  • If, perchance, you did run the pump when the tank was low, you may have gotten air in the lines someplace. If all faucets/shower are getting a good flow of water but the pump still gets loud, open/close the low point drains to get the air out of the system.
